Two identical balls A and B having velocities of 0.5 m s$$-$$1 and $$-$$0.3 m s$$-$$1 respectively collide elastically in one dimension. The velocities of B and A after the collision respectively will be :
A
$$-$$0.5 m s$$-$$1 and 0.3 m s$$-$$1
B
0.5 m s$$-$$1 and $$-$$0.3 m s$$-$$1
C
$$-$$0.3 m s$$-$$1 and 0.5 m s$$-$$1
D
0.3 m s$$-$$1 and 0.5 m s$$-$$1

A light rod of length $$l$$ has two masses m1 and m2 attached to its two ends. The moment of inertia of the system about an axis perpendicular to the rod and passing through the centre of mass is
A
$${{{m_1}{m_2}} \over {{m_1} + {m_2}}}{l^2}$$
B
$${{{m_1} + {m_2}} \over {{m_1}{m_2}}}{l^2}$$
C
$$\left( {{m_1} + {m_2}} \right){l^2}$$
D
$$\sqrt {{m_1}{m_2}} \,{l^2}$$

A solid sphere of mass m and radius R is rotating about its diameter. A solid cylinder of same mass and same radius is also rotating about its geometrical axis with an angular speed twice that of the sphere. The ratio of their kinetic energies of rotation (Esphere / Ecylinder) will be
A
2 : 3
B
1 : 5
C
1 : 4
D
3 : 1
